// MAX_SWAP_DEPTH controls how far the Brindlewood timetable solver
// will backtrack when resolving room conflicts. Raising it past 6
// blows up solve time on the Oakhaven dataset; lowering it leaves
// Friday afternoons unschedulable. Do not change without rerunning
// the full regression suite. Last validated against the build below.

pipeline stamp: htk9_6ce9d33c5

**Q: Why does the string extraction script skip files under `legacy/`?**

The Lingotail extractor ignores that directory by design; those templates use the old Fennwick placeholder syntax and would corrupt the catalog. If you need to migrate them, run the converter first. The extractor's vault config is unlocked with the recovery passphrase below.

recovery phrase for fajep-yaweg: gilath-sorox-wenius-rusdor-keliel-zorius

The Moonquay tide widget currently shifts predicted high-tide times by one hour during the daylight-saving transition week, because the chart renderer applies the offset twice. The proposed fix normalizes all timestamps to station-local standard time before rendering and adds a regression test covering both transition dates. Code is ready and reviewed; we need formal sign-off before the Friday release train. Please bring this to the weekly sync for approval by the responsible engineer named below.

named custodian: Brivan Eliath Quenox Frador

Subject: New GPU memory profiler is live

Hey all — welcome to the folks who joined this sprint! We just shipped Memvista, our in-house GPU memory profiling tool, to the release channel. It hooks into the Corvid training jobs automatically and flags allocation spikes over 2GB. Docs are in the team wiki under Tooling. If you want to poke at it, grab the build referenced right here.

pipeline stamp: htk31_f769b577b3028a4e9958e5bb8d1259a

# Break-Glass Access — Ledgerline ORM Refactor

Welcome aboard! While we untangle the legacy Ledgerline ORM layer, some migrations can deadlock the staging database. Normal fix: wait it out. If it's blocking your whole day, use break-glass access to kill the stuck session yourself — but log it in the refactor channel afterward, always. The break-glass console lives behind the ops gateway and prompts once. Enter the recovery passphrase shown below.

vault phrase of tajeg-tageg = pelix-druix-holius-briael-zorwyn-frawyn-fraox-norok-drueth-aldiel